Retro classic Archon will be returning to the PC after more than 26 years of drifting, forgotten through the miasma of license and development troubles, according to React Games. Archon, for those not in the know, is a highly regarded strategy-action game, which combines a Chess-like strategy element with simple one on one action battles between different pieces. React Games previously bought the game to the iPhone too, with a second Archon game on the way called Archon: Conquest. The new iPhone title will include four single player campaigns, 60 quests and support for Ngmoco's Plus+ service as well. The new PC game will update the classic gameplay with a graphical overhaul, four-player multiplayer, new boards and a series of achievements and leaderboards.
